Benefits of Incorporating Business in the State of Wyoming:

Benefits of incorporation in Wyoming may be substantial for your business, if your business is located in another state, your home state's corporate filing fees and reports may still be required. We can provide you with information about your area so you can decide if a Wyoming corporation is the right move for you.

There are a number of business entity types to consider when you are deciding the structure of your Wyoming business. The most advantageous entities to form in Wyoming are typically corporations or LLCs. Although other entity options are possible, these are the entities that offer the highest level of liability protection in Wyoming . As you review the characteristics of incorporating or forming an LLC in Wyoming , be sure to keep in mind both the present and future needs of your business. Often, when you start a business it begins as a small organization.

  • No state corporate income tax
  • No tax on corporate shares
  • No franchise tax
  • Minimal annual fees
  • One-person corporation is allowed
  • Stockholders are not revealed to the State
  • No annual report is required until the anniversary of the incorporation date
  • Unlimited stock is allowed, of any par value
  • Nominee shareholders are allowed
  • Share certificates are not required
  • Minimal initial filing fees
  • No minimum capital requirements
  • Meetings may be held anywhere
  • Officers, directors, employees and agents are statutorily indemnified
  • Continuance procedure (allows Wyoming to adopt a corporation formed in another state)
  • Doesn't collect corporate income tax information to share with the IRS

Your question is not clear but let me give you some  guidelines: If you are converting your C-Corporation to an S-Corporation then you will use the same Employer Identification Number. EIN only change If you are changing the structure of your company from corporation to Limited Liability Company (LLC).
